Ofsted did not give an overall grade. Between September 2024 and September 2025 inspections graded each area of a school's work without a single overall judgement, ahead of the move to report cards. How Ofsted report cards work

Progress measures ended nationally after the 2022/23 school year, when the key stage 1 assessments they were based on were stopped. Blank progress figures in later years are not missing school data.

Progress 8 is paused nationally for the 2024/25 and 2025/26 school years. Those pupils sat no key stage 2 tests during the Covid pandemic, so there is no starting point to measure progress from. A blank figure here is not missing school data.
